Looking to remortgage in Middlesbrough?

A remortgage will typically occur when the introductory period or fixed-term of a mortgage is heading towards its end. Most homeowners will look at their remortgage options at this point, so that they can explore what they can do next. Some will look for a better mortgage deal, some will release equity from their property. No matter the reason, our expert mortgage advisors in Middlesbrough are here to help.



If you had previously used the services of Middlesbroughmoneyman for the mortgage you currently have, then you will typically be given a reminder from a member of our team, 6 months before your fixed-term is due to end. You may feel like this is too soon, though we actively encourage it at this point as it allows you to prepare in advance, to avoid falling onto your mortgage lenders Standard Variable Rate, which is typically more expensive.



In some occasions, people will look at their options for raising capital when it comes to their remortgage, also known as remortgaging to release equity. Many homeowners will look to do this as a means of funding home improvements and alterations, as well as to consolidate any debts.

What is a remortgage in Middlesbrough?

Accorion Arrow

A remortgage in Middlesbrough is the process of taking out a brand new mortgage, on the home you are already in, once you are at the point when your existing deal is set to end.



A lot of homeowners will choose a fixed-rate mortgage, to keep their payments consistent for a period of time, and then once that period has ended, remortgage in Middlesbrough to access a better deal.



In order for your mortgage to be classed as a remortgage in Middlesbrough, you will be taking out your mortgage with a different mortgage lender to the one you had previously. If you were to take out a new mortgage with the same mortgage lender, this is called a product transfer.

Can I consolidate my debts into my mortgage in Middlesbrough?

Accorion Arrow

This answer can change depending on the lender that you’ve used and how large the unsecured debt is that you’ve built up. But yes, sometimes you may be able to remortgage in Middlesbrough to incorporate your debts into your mortgage. When you do this, your monthly mortgage payments will increase and so could your mortgage term.



You should think carefully before securing other debts against your home. By adding your unsecured debts to your mortgage, which is secured on your home, you are potentially putting your home at risk if you cannot make the required repayments.



Although the total monthly cost of servicing your debt may have reduced, the total cost of repayment may still have risen as the term of your mortgage is longer than it may have taken to repay the debts originally.

Common Remortgage Scenarios

Remortgage to Find a Better Deal

Accorion Arrow

Once you are at a point where your initial fixed-term is due to end soon, it may be time to start looking at your remortgage options in Middlesbrough. This is typically done to avoid falling onto your mortgage lenders standard variable rate (SVR), which can become quite costly for homeowners.



Because of the high interest rates associated with SVR’s, remortgaging is a popular option amongst homeowners. From a remortgage for a better deal, to a remortgage for home improvements, there are a lot of reasons as to why a homeowner will remortgage their home.

Remortgage to Fund Home Improvements

Accorion Arrow

During our time as a mortgage broker in Middlesbrough, we have spoken to many different homeowners who have decided they would like to release some equity from their home via remortgaging, to fund some necessary home improvements.



Typical reasons for this are to fund the works on an extension, a home office for working from home, a new kitchen or even a new bedroom if you are planning on expanding your family.



When you look to remortgage your home in order to fund these home improvements, it is important to gather any potential quotations for the works you would like to have carried out, as your mortgage lender will likely want to see these.

Remortgage to Remove a Name

Accorion Arrow

If you are the co-owner of a property in Middlesbrough, you may want to remove your co-owners name from the mortgage, whether it be due to divorce & separation or something else, you will need to remortgage the property in order to take out a mortgage in your own name.



Please note that the other party will have to agree first, before you remove them. This process will be fairly similar for you the first time round, if you are the one remaining on the mortgage. You’ll need to prove affordability (the lender is going from the security of two income sources, to one) and that you are creditworthy.
